The U.S. Coast Guard needs a small business to provide motor controllers for its anchor windlass control boxes.

Key Details

  • What exactly do they need? The Coast Guard needs motor controllers for its new anchor windlass control boxes. The controllers must support the 270 A & B Class Port & Stbd Schellhorn-Albrecht anchor windlass. The offeror must be an authorized distributor of the OEM (Schoellhorn-Albrecht Machine Co.) and provide genuine OEM parts.
  • What's the contract structure and timeline? The Coast Guard intends to award a Firm Fixed Price Contract on an all or none basis to a responsible offeror. The contract will be awarded based on the lowest price technically acceptable.
  • How will they pick the winner? The Coast Guard will evaluate proposals based on the offeror's ability to provide the required motor controllers and their price.
  • When and how do you bid? Submit your quote by July 24, 2026, at 10:00 am Eastern Standard Time. Include a letter from the OEM verifying that you are an authorized distributor and that they will supply genuine OEM parts. Also, provide your company Tax Information Number (TIN) with your offer.

Who can apply

  • Must be 8(a) certified (a small-business program for socially or economically disadvantaged owners)
